Overview of Canada's Immigration Policy
Canada's immigration policy is based on several underlying goals:
Stimulating the economy
Family reunification
Offering protection to refugees and vulnerable individuals
The Canadian government has yearly immigration plans to decide who and how many people can come and under what conditions. The plans are not fixed but vary based on the nation's labor market, population needs, and global conditions.

Types of Immigration
Canada has a few options based on your background and objectives. These are the general categories:
1. Economic Immigration
It is the largest category. Canada imports investors, entrepreneurs, and skilled labor to boost its economy.
Under economic immigration, there are:
Express Entry – For skilled workers, educated workers, and language proficient workers.
Provincial Nominee Program (PNP) – For individuals selected by individual provinces according to regional requirements.
Start-Up Visa – For start-ups who are looking to start a new innovative business in Canada.
Self-Employed Program – For persons in cultural or sporting fields.

2. Family Sponsorship
Canada allows permanent residents and citizens to sponsor immediate family members, such as:
Spouses and common-law partners
Dependent children
Parents and grandparents

3. Student Pathway
Canada is among the leading countries for foreign students. With the world's best universities, a secure atmosphere, and the option to remain on after graduation, it's no surprise that most opt for Canada for study.
To study in Canada, you will require the study permit. Upon graduation, most students can apply for a Post-Graduate Work Permit (PGWP) and eventually become permanent residents.

4. Refugees and Humanitarian Programs
Canada resettles individuals who are escaping war, persecution, or extreme risk. Canada has robust refugee and asylum programs and cooperates with the United Nations and private sponsors to assist individuals in need.
While this is different from economic or family immigration, it is an expression of Canada's commitment to being a compassionate and fair society.

Canada's Future Immigration Goals
Canada will absorb more than 500,000 new immigrants every year in the coming years. The emphasis will remain on skilled immigrants, foreign graduates of universities, and entrepreneurs. Provinces are also being accorded increasing autonomy under the PNP to address regional needs.
